服务器虚拟化的三种方式,深入解析服务器虚拟化的三种方式,硬件虚拟化、操作系统虚拟化和应用虚拟化
- 综合资讯
- 2024-10-31 12:03:35
- 2

服务器虚拟化包括硬件虚拟化、操作系统虚拟化和应用虚拟化三种方式。硬件虚拟化通过底层硬件实现,操作系统虚拟化在操作系统层面实现,应用虚拟化则在应用层面实现。这三种方式各有...
服务器虚拟化包括硬件虚拟化、操作系统虚拟化和应用虚拟化三种方式。硬件虚拟化通过底层硬件实现,操作系统虚拟化在操作系统层面实现,应用虚拟化则在应用层面实现。这三种方式各有优势,可提高服务器资源利用率,降低成本。
随着信息技术的飞速发展,虚拟化技术已经成为当今IT领域的重要技术之一,服务器虚拟化作为一种高效、安全、灵活的IT资源管理方式,已经成为许多企业降低成本、提高资源利用率的重要手段,本文将深入解析服务器虚拟化的三种方式:硬件虚拟化、操作系统虚拟化和应用虚拟化,以帮助读者全面了解服务器虚拟化的应用场景和优势。
硬件虚拟化
1、定义
硬件虚拟化是指在硬件层面实现虚拟化,通过硬件辅助技术,将一台物理服务器分割成多个虚拟机(VM),每个虚拟机拥有独立的操作系统和硬件资源,硬件虚拟化技术主要包括以下几种:
(1)Intel VT-x:Intel推出的硬件虚拟化技术,支持虚拟化扩展,提高虚拟机的性能。
(2)AMD-V:AMD推出的硬件虚拟化技术,同样支持虚拟化扩展,提高虚拟机的性能。
(3)SVM:IBM Power处理器上的硬件虚拟化技术,支持虚拟化扩展,提高虚拟机的性能。
2、优势
(1)提高资源利用率:硬件虚拟化可以将一台物理服务器分割成多个虚拟机,提高硬件资源的利用率。
(2)简化IT管理:硬件虚拟化可以简化IT管理,降低运维成本。
(3)提高系统安全性:硬件虚拟化可以将不同的虚拟机隔离开来,提高系统安全性。
操作系统虚拟化
1、定义
操作系统虚拟化是指在操作系统层面实现虚拟化,通过虚拟化软件将一台物理服务器分割成多个虚拟机,每个虚拟机运行在同一个操作系统中,操作系统虚拟化技术主要包括以下几种:
(1)Xen:开源的操作系统虚拟化技术,支持多种操作系统,具有高性能和稳定性。
(2)VMware ESXi:VMware推出的商业操作系统虚拟化产品,支持多种操作系统,具有高性能和稳定性。
(3)KVM:Linux内核虚拟化技术,支持多种操作系统,具有高性能和稳定性。
2、优势
(1)提高资源利用率:操作系统虚拟化可以将一台物理服务器分割成多个虚拟机,提高硬件资源的利用率。
(2)简化IT管理:操作系统虚拟化可以简化IT管理,降低运维成本。
(3)提高系统安全性:操作系统虚拟化可以将不同的虚拟机隔离开来,提高系统安全性。
应用虚拟化
1、定义
应用虚拟化是指在应用层面实现虚拟化,通过虚拟化软件将应用程序与操作系统和硬件资源分离,实现应用程序的独立运行,应用虚拟化技术主要包括以下几种:
(1)VMware ThinApp:VMware推出的应用虚拟化产品,可以将应用程序打包成虚拟文件,实现应用程序的独立运行。
(2)App-V:Microsoft推出的应用虚拟化产品,可以将应用程序打包成虚拟文件,实现应用程序的独立运行。
(3)Citrix XenApp:Citrix推出的应用虚拟化产品,可以将应用程序打包成虚拟文件,实现应用程序的独立运行。
2、优势
(1)简化IT管理:应用虚拟化可以将应用程序与操作系统和硬件资源分离,降低IT管理难度。
(2)提高系统安全性:应用虚拟化可以将应用程序与操作系统和硬件资源分离,提高系统安全性。
(3)提高用户体验:应用虚拟化可以实现应用程序的跨平台运行,提高用户体验。
服务器虚拟化技术作为一种高效、安全、灵活的IT资源管理方式,已经成为当今IT领域的重要技术之一,本文深入解析了服务器虚拟化的三种方式:硬件虚拟化、操作系统虚拟化和应用虚拟化,以帮助读者全面了解服务器虚拟化的应用场景和优势,在实际应用中,企业可以根据自身需求选择合适的虚拟化技术,以提高资源利用率、降低运维成本和提高系统安全性。
本文链接:https://www.zhitaoyun.cn/461211.html
发表评论